Understanding HVAC Maintenance: Tips for Longevity
Ensuring your warm system and AC unit operates properly requires consistent upkeep. Ignoring these tasks can lead to expensive problems and a reduced lifespan. A routine inspection can eliminate major issues. Here are a few important tips to maximize the life of your heating and cooling system:
- Change your air filters regularly.
- Arrange annual professional maintenance checks.
- Maintain the area around your AC unit is unobstructed of debris.
- Examine and clean coils.
- Think about a device operational evaluation.
Following simple procedures will help you benefit from time of consistent heating and cooling and minimize potential costs.
HVAC Energy Efficiency: Saving Money & the Planet
Improving your heating system's performance can lead to major savings on your utility costs while also reducing your environmental impact. Modern climate control systems are designed with innovative technology to improve fuel use. Simple measures, like regular maintenance, proper sealing, and choosing an green model when upgrading your current system, can provide a substantial return on investment and contribute to a healthier world. Consider a qualified assessment to determine the best strategy for your property.
